Thanks for the response. That's very interesting, though I wonder if it could actually be header related. Based on the videos, I know for sure there are exactly 64 frames in the first movie, for instance. My m_FrameRead is only increased if avcodec_decode_video2 says it was able to get a picture. My thinking is that if it was a header that was read, that function wouldn't set frameFinished to "true". So av_read_frame hits the EOF when my m_FrameRead counter is only 56.
Are you saying that perhaps the av_read_frame is reading a bunch of data (header + frames) and my avcodec_decode_video2 says there's no picture because there's header data in there. Then a few frames later (or maybe next frame), av_read_frame reads more data, now including the 9th 'frame' and finally avcodec_decode_video2 decodes and I increment my counter (which would be now 1 when I'd want it to be 9).
